Global Investments in Water Infrastructure
Significant financial commitments have been made globally to upgrade and expand water infrastructure. Multilateral institutions such as the World Bank and regional development banks are providing loans and grants to support large-scale projects including water treatment plants, distribution networks, and sanitation systems. These investments not only focus on expanding capacity but also on integrating modern technologies such as smart meters and leak detection systems to improve efficiency.
Technological Innovations Driving Water Infrastructure Advancements
Advances in technology are playing a crucial role in transforming water infrastructure. Innovations like remote sensing, real-time monitoring, and automated control systems enable more effective management of water resources. Moreover, newer water purification methods that consume less energy are being incorporated into infrastructure projects, making water treatment more sustainable. These technological enhancements contribute to reducing water losses and ensuring water quality standards are met consistently.
Policy Frameworks Supporting Water Infrastructure Development
Effective policy frameworks are essential in facilitating the development and maintenance of water infrastructure. Many countries have introduced regulations that promote public-private partnerships, encourage community involvement, and prioritize investments in underserved areas. International guidelines, such as those from the United Nations and the World Health Organization, provide standards that guide the planning and execution of water infrastructure projects, ensuring they meet safety, environmental, and social requirements.
Challenges in Scaling Water Infrastructure Access
Despite progress, several challenges persist in scaling water infrastructure worldwide. Rapid urbanization, climate change, and population growth increase demand and strain existing systems. Additionally, financial constraints and institutional weaknesses can delay project implementation. Addressing these challenges requires coordinated efforts, capacity building, and innovative financing models to ensure that water infrastructure projects are resilient and inclusive.
Impact of Water Infrastructure on Health and Economy
Improved water infrastructure has direct positive impacts on public health by reducing waterborne diseases and enhancing hygiene. Furthermore, it supports economic development by providing industries and agriculture with reliable water supplies. Investments in water infrastructure also create jobs and improve quality of life in communities. International organizations emphasize that sustainable water infrastructure is a foundational element for achieving several Sustainable Development Goals, particularly those related to health, poverty reduction, and environmental sustainability.
